Tawadkar under pressure from Parrikar: Dhavalikar

MGP President Deepak Dhavalikar refuted claims that the MGP had imposed conditions on former BJP minister Ramesh Tawadkar, if he were to contest on the MGP ticket from Canacona constituency.


PONDA
 
“We never asked Tawadkar to campaign against Gawade in Priol and in other constituencies of Sanguem, Quepem and Sanvordem,” claimed Dhavalikar late Monday evening, while responding to queries from The Goan.   
Asked why had Tawadkar refused the MGP ticket from Canacona constituency, Dhavalikar replied: “Tawadkar is under pressure from Defence Minister Manohar Parrikar and this could be the reason why Tawadkar is not accepting the MGP ticket.”   
Asked if the MGP would put up a new candidate, since efforts to get Tawadkar to contest on the MGP ticket had failed, Dhavalikar added: “We will declare our candidate for Canacona on Tuesday.”
